How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Brightleaf District?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Brightleaf District Studio Apartments | $1,684 | $1,000 | $3,528 |
Brightleaf District 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,965 | $999 | $4,105 |
Brightleaf District 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,787 | $950 | $8,732 |
Brightleaf District 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,883 | $1,450 | $7,925 |
Brightleaf District 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,439 | $1,611 | $4,400 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Studio Brightleaf District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Brightleaf District with Studio?
Currently the most affordable Studio in Brightleaf District is at Icon Downtown Durham listed at $1,000.
How much is the average rent for a Studio Brightleaf District Apartment?
The average rent for a Studio Apartment in Brightleaf District is $1,684.
What is the largest available Studio Brightleaf District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Brightleaf District is a 848 square feet unit starting from $1,769 at West Village.
What is the average size for Brightleaf District Studio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Studio rental in Brightleaf District is currently 549 sq ft.
